grand steward
The is an official within the Imperial Household Agency of Japan. He is the senior official of the Imperial Household,〔(The Imperial Household Agency ) at Cultural Profiles of Japan〕 and is responsible for managing the part of the household staff who are ''omote'', or "outside the house"; these employees serve as drivers, cooks, gardeners, or administrative officials.〔(The Future of Japan's Monarchy ), ''Time Asia'' Magazine〕 The current Grand Steward is Noriyuki Kazaoka, who took up the position in June 2012, succeeding Shingo Haketa.
==History of the position==
The origins of the structure of the Imperial Household can be traced back to the reign of Emperor Mommu, with the organisation of the government structure in 701 AD.〔(History of the Imperial Household Agency ) at the Imperial Household Agency official site〕
